Understanding the Current Market Landscape


The property market is influenced by many factors—interest rates, government policies, and buyer demand, to name a few. Right now, we’re seeing a mix of challenges and opportunities. Interest rates have shifted, which affects borrowing costs. At the same time, housing supply is tight in many areas, pushing prices up.


For example, if you’re thinking about buying your first home, you might notice that prices in popular suburbs have increased. This means you’ll need to plan your budget carefully and consider options like government grants or first home buyer schemes. On the other hand, if you’re looking to invest, some regional areas are showing strong growth potential due to lifestyle changes and remote work trends.


Here’s a quick snapshot of what’s happening:


  • Interest rates: Slightly higher than last year, impacting loan repayments.

  • Supply: Limited new listings in major cities.

  • Demand: Strong from both owner-occupiers and investors.

  • Government incentives: Various grants and schemes still available.


These factors combine to create a dynamic market where timing and knowledge are key.

Recent Property Insights: What Buyers and Investors Should Watch


Keeping an eye on recent property insights helps you spot opportunities and avoid pitfalls. One important trend is the growing interest in regional properties. Many buyers are moving away from city centres, attracted by more space and affordability. This shift is driving up prices in areas that were previously overlooked.


If you’re upgrading your home, consider how these trends affect your choices. Properties with flexible spaces for home offices or outdoor areas are in high demand. This means homes that offer lifestyle benefits often sell faster and at better prices.


For investors, rental demand remains strong, especially in areas with growing populations. However, it’s crucial to assess the local economy and infrastructure plans before committing. Look for suburbs with planned transport upgrades or new schools, as these can boost property values over time.


Tips for Buyers and Investors


Here are some tips to keep in mind:


  1. Research local market conditions before making an offer.

  2. Consider future growth areas rather than just current hotspots.

  3. Factor in your borrowing capacity with the latest interest rates.

  4. Use professional advice to navigate complex loan options.


By staying informed, you can make choices that align with your financial goals and lifestyle needs.

How to Navigate Financing in Today’s Market


Financing is a crucial part of any property purchase or refinance. With recent changes in interest rates and lending policies, it’s more important than ever to understand your options. Whether you’re buying your first home or refinancing to consolidate debt, getting the right loan can save you thousands.


Assessing Your Financial Situation


Start by reviewing your current financial situation. How much deposit do you have? What is your income and expense profile? Lenders will look closely at these details. If you’re upgrading or investing, you might need a larger loan or a different type of mortgage product.


Here are some practical steps to take:


  • Get pre-approval before you start house hunting. This gives you a clear budget.

  • Compare loan features like fixed vs variable rates, offset accounts, and redraw facilities.

  • Consider loan term flexibility to suit your future plans.

  • Seek expert advice from mortgage brokers who understand the local market.


Remember, refinancing can also be a smart move if you want to reduce repayments or access equity for renovations or investments. Keep an eye on fees and break costs to ensure refinancing is worthwhile.
